House . City - Perugia

Built in 2023, the residential part of the villa is entirely arranged on one level for an area of approximately 86 sqm, featuring bright, functional rooms designed to ensure the utmost daily comfort.

The entrance leads to the open-plan living area, consisting of a lounge and an open kitchen, a welcoming and convivial space that opens directly onto the splendid panoramic terrace. This outdoor area is a true extension of the home, ideal for al fresco dining, relaxing moments, and for enjoying the magnificent view over the Umbrian hills.

The sleeping area includes two bedrooms and two bathrooms. The master bedroom has an en suite bathroom, a walk-in wardrobe, and a charming private small terrace with a semicircular shape, perfect for enjoying the more secluded outdoor spaces of the property in complete tranquility.

On the lower ground floor there are additional ancillary rooms that greatly enhance the usability of the property: an attractive tavern/rustic room of approximately 85 sqm, a large garage of approximately 58 sqm, and a technical room of approximately 15 sqm.

Outside, the approximately 1.5 hectares of land surrounding the property include olive trees and rows of vineyards, helping to create a setting of great charm and authenticity.
